QUESTION: How is it possible to keep two male rats together in the same cage?
ANSWER: First you have to introduce the males to eachother in a roomy place none of them have been before. If you don't usually let them spend time on the kitchen floor you can use this. Put both or on the floor and watch them. Be sure to do this an evening that you want to spend at home.
You could also use a new or totally cleaned out cage. It is important put in both males at the same time. If you put in one first and the next after as little as ten minutes you may have a big fight on your hands.
To be sure they don't have a reason to fight both rats can be bathed with a perfumed shampoo, to smell the same.
If they do not go on fine together there is probably something wrong - then you should neuter the most aggressive male or both.

NOTE: Rats are meant to live together in big hoards, and the normal rat behaviour is not to fight as long as there is enough space and food and so on. Males bond to eachother and may become close friends.
